本研究主要目的在於建構我國高級職業學校行政人員協力領導與學校效能之評量指標,並藉以了解行政人員知覺上述二者之重要性與現況,以作為我國高級職業學校提升領導效能與學校效能之參考。為達研究目的,首先進行協力領導理論與學校效能理論等相關文獻分析,並以美國Sam Houston State University的Irby, Brown & Duffy等人所發展的「組織及領導效能量表II(OLEI II)」為基礎,且參考國內外學校效能研究與量表,建構「高級職業學校協力領導與學校效能調查問卷」為研究工具,針對全國高級職業學校採取多階段隨機抽樣,抽取高級職業學校校長47人,行政人員1,222人,分別進行問卷調查,有效問卷回收率分別為87.2%與82.9%。研究資料使用SPSS 12.0版與Lisrel 8.8版進行描述性統計、項目分析、因素分析、信度分析、相依樣本t檢定、單因子變異數分析與線性結構方程模式等統計方法以考驗研究假設。本研究根據研究結果獲致以下七點結論:
一、「高級職業學校協力領導與學校效能調查問卷」具有良好的信度與效度。
二、46〜60歲、碩士、校長、處室主任、年資9〜12年與北區學校,在協力領導部分領域上知覺到較高的重要性,但其效應量較低。
三、男性人員、46〜60歲、博士、校長、處室主任與年資9〜12年,知覺到高級職業學校行政人員在協力領導現況的部分領域有較高的表現,但其效應量較低。
四、博碩士、處室主任、科主任、年資13年以上與北區學校,在學校效能部分領域上知覺到較高的重要性,但其效應量較低。
五、46歲以上、博碩士、校長與北區、中區學校,知覺到高級職業學校行政人員在學校效能現況的部分領域有較高的表現,但其效應量較低。
六、高級職業學校行政人員在協力領導與學校效能現況上的知覺有密切的關係。
The main purpose of this study was to construct measurement criteria of synergistic leadership and school effectiveness which adapt to vocational high schools’ administrative staff on Taiwan (R.O.C.), and explore the important perception and status quo. The measurement instrument of “Synergistic Leadership and School Effectiveness in Vocational High School on Taiwan Questionnaire” was developed based on the “Organizational Leadership and Effectiveness Inventory II, OLEI II”. The questionnaires were mailed to 47 vocational high school principals and 1,222 vocational high school administrative staffs which were sampled by multi-stage random. The effective return rates of principals and administrative staffs were 87.2% and 82.9%.
According to the results of literature review and statistical analyses, the conclusions of this study were as follows:
1.There were good validity and reliability in “Synergistic Leadership and School Effectiveness in Vocational High School on Taiwan Questionnaire”.
2.In important perception of synergistic leadership measurement criteria of vocational high school staffs, there was difference among age, educational degree, positions, work years, and school location.
3.In status quo of synergistic leadership measurement criteria of vocational high school staffs, there was difference among sexes, age, educational degree, positions, and work years.
4.In important perception of school effectiveness measurement criteria of vocational high school staffs, there was difference among educational degree, positions, work years, and school location.
5.In status quo of school effectiveness measurement criteria of vocational high school staffs, there was difference among age, educational degree, positions, and school location.
6.The domains and whole domain of synergistic leadership and school effectiveness were positively and significantly correlated in vocational high school staffs.
